EGTA tetrasodium; sodium 3,12-bis(carboxylatomethyl)-6,9-dioxa-3,12-diazatetradecanedioate; CAS No.: 13368-13-3; EGTA tetrasodium. PROPERTIES: EGTA tetrasodium is a calcium chelating agent appearing as a white to off-white crystalline powder. This EGTA tetrasodium compound has a molecular weight of 462.48 g/mol with a pH range of 7-9 in solution. It is highly soluble in water but insoluble in most organic solvents. The substance is hygroscopic and should be stored in a tightly sealed container at room temperature. It is advisable to avoid exposure to high temperatures and moisture. In terms of safety, EGTA tetrasodium may cause eye irritation and skin irritation, so protective measures are recommended during handling. APPLICATIONS: EGTA tetrasodium is primarily used in biological research to control intracellular calcium levels. It serves as a calcium ion buffer in cell culture media and electrophysiological experiments. In molecular biology, EGTA tetrasodium is utilized to inhibit calcium-dependent enzymes such as calmodulin and protein kinase C. It also finds application in diagnostic assays for measuring calcium-regulated processes. In pharmacological studies, it helps elucidate calcium signaling pathways and their role in disease mechanisms.
